MSC has signed an agreement to operate an inland terminal in Bangladesh.
MSC subsidiary Medlog has signed a 22-year concession agreement to operate Pangaon Inland Container Terminal (PICT) located along the Buriganga River near the Bangladeshi capital, Dhaka.
Medlog plans to expand its handling capacity from 116,000 TEUs to 160,000 TEUs and improve its logistics supply chain with digitalization plans to optimize logistics management. Inland barges will link PICT to other river terminals and seaports.
“Our investment in the Pangaon Inland Container Terminal reflects our belief that Bangladesh has the potential to become one of South Asia’s major gateways for regional and global trade,” says MSC CEO Soren Toft.
